Rachel Moran is an author, journalist and memoir coach from Dublin, Ireland. Her memoir ‘Paid For – My Journey Through Prostitution’ was first published in 2013 and was an immediate bestseller, holding its place in the Irish top ten list for sixteen weeks. It has since been published in fourteen countries, including translations in German, Italian, Korean and French. ‘Paid For’ was published by Norton in the United States in 2015, where it is still in print.
